This subcontract for the City of Lawrenceville involves the application of permanently resilient acoustical sealants and backing materials for facility projects. The scope of work includes sealing isolation joints, perimeter and control joints in masonry and gypsum, barrier ceiling perimeters, and various penetrations. All work must be performed using non-hardening silicone or polyurethane caulking in accordance with ASTM C919 and C920-11 standards to ensure proper acoustic separation. The project is categorized under NAICS code 238390 and was posted on September 15, 2026, with a response deadline of October 15, 2026. The contract is managed by the City of Lawrenceville in Georgia and is intended for subcontractors supporting prime contractors on these specific facility improvements.
